Choose GitChameleon if…
- Tags unique to GitChameleon: docker, python environment management, virtual environments.
- GitChameleon ships Docker support for self-hosted deployment.
- When you need consistent Python environment setups across multiple developers or teams for projects that require specific versions such as 3.7, 3.9, or 3.10.
When NOT to use GitChameleon
- When you are working with Python versions not supported by GitChameleon, such as earlier than 3.7 or later than 3.10.
- If your team prefers GUI-based tools for environment setup over command-line utilities like Make and Docker commands.
